  • Posted by poisondartfrog (SE Kentucky - Zone 7a) on Jul 6, 2014 9:24 AM concerning plant:
    My seeds came from Baker Creek. This variety is highly variable as to size and color, ranging from 3 inches across to nearly eight inches across and from orange red through scarlet. Most are semi-cactus flowered, but some are not at all quilled.
